Diversity - 의미

The state or quality of being different or varied

예: The diversity of cultures in the city makes it a vibrant place to live.
사용: formal문맥: academic discussions, workplace diversity training
메모: Often used in discussions related to inclusion and representation

A range of different things or people

예: The company values diversity in its workforce, including individuals from various backgrounds.
사용: formal문맥: diversity initiatives, organizational policies
메모: Commonly associated with promoting equality and tolerance

The condition of having people who are different races or who have different cultures in a group or organization

예: The university campus celebrates diversity through events that showcase different cultural traditions.
사용: formal문맥: diversity programs, multicultural events
메모: Often used in discussions on multiculturalism and social integration

The variety or range of different things that exist

예: The biodiversity of the rainforest is essential for maintaining ecological balance.
사용: formal문맥: environmental discussions, scientific research
메모: Commonly used in scientific and environmental contexts

Diversity의 동의어

variety

Variety refers to a range of different things or elements.
예: The store offers a variety of fruits and vegetables.
메모: Variety emphasizes the presence of different kinds within a group.

multiformity

Multiformity suggests the existence of many different forms or types.
예: The multiformity of opinions in the debate was evident.
메모: Multiformity emphasizes the diverse forms or types within a context.

heterogeneity

Heterogeneity indicates diversity in composition or character.
예: The heterogeneity of the student body enriches the learning environment.
메모: Heterogeneity specifically refers to the presence of differences within a group or system.

assortment

Assortment denotes a varied collection or selection of different types of things.
예: The buffet offered an assortment of dishes from different cuisines.
메모: Assortment highlights the diverse mix or range of items available.

disparity

Disparity signifies a marked difference or inequality.
예: There was a noticeable disparity in income levels among the residents.
메모: Disparity emphasizes the contrast or discrepancy between elements.

Diversity 표현, 자주 쓰이는 구문

Unity in Diversity

This phrase emphasizes the idea of different elements coming together in harmony despite their differences.
예: Our company promotes unity in diversity by celebrating various cultural festivals together.
메모: The phrase shifts the focus from the concept of merely having differences to actively working together in harmony.

Strength in Diversity

This phrase highlights the advantage of having a variety of backgrounds, skills, and perspectives within a group.
예: The team's strength in diversity allowed them to approach challenges from multiple perspectives.
메모: It emphasizes that diversity is not just about differences but about the collective strength that arises from these differences.

Embrace Diversity

To embrace diversity means to accept and welcome differences in culture, beliefs, and backgrounds.
예: It's important for a global company to embrace diversity in its workforce to foster innovation and creativity.
메모: It goes beyond acknowledging diversity to actively accepting and integrating it into one's environment.

Cultural Diversity

This phrase refers to the variety of cultures, traditions, and practices present in a particular place or group.
예: The city's cultural diversity is reflected in its wide range of restaurants serving international cuisine.
메모: It specifies that the diversity being discussed pertains specifically to different cultural backgrounds.

Diversity and Inclusion

This phrase emphasizes not only the presence of diverse elements but also the active effort to include and involve them.
예: The company's commitment to diversity and inclusion led to a more welcoming and equitable work environment.
메모: It underscores the importance of not just having diversity but also ensuring that all individuals feel valued and included.

Celebrate Diversity

To celebrate diversity means to recognize and honor the differences and unique qualities of individuals or groups.
예: The school organized a multicultural fair to celebrate the diversity of its student body.
메모: It involves actively acknowledging and appreciating diversity by commemorating it in a positive manner.

Diversity of Thought

This phrase refers to the range of perspectives, ideas, and opinions that individuals bring to a discussion or decision-making process.
예: Encouraging a diversity of thought among team members can lead to more innovative solutions to problems.
메모: It specifically focuses on the variation of ideas and viewpoints rather than just demographic differences.

Diversity 일상적인 (속어) 표현

Melting Pot

Refers to a place or situation where people from various backgrounds and cultures come together and mix.
예: Our school is a true melting pot of different cultures and backgrounds.
메모: Focuses on the blending or mixing of different elements rather than just acknowledging their presence.

Rainbow Coalition

Describes a diverse group or alliance, especially in terms of political or social causes.
예: The organization aims to build a rainbow coalition of members from diverse communities.
메모: Emphasizes the variety and colorful nature of the different groups within the coalition.

Patchwork Quilt

Compares diversity to a patchwork quilt, with each piece representing a different cultural or social element.
예: Our neighborhood is like a patchwork quilt, with each house reflecting a different cultural influence.
메모: Highlights the idea of different parts coming together to create a cohesive whole.

Tapestry of Cultures

Describes a diverse community or society as a rich and intricate tapestry made up of various cultures.
예: Our city is a beautiful tapestry of cultures, each contributing to its vibrant atmosphere.
메모: Evokes the image of interwoven threads, symbolizing the interconnectedness and richness of diverse cultures.

Salad Bowl

Compares diverse cultures living together to a salad bowl, where each ingredient retains its individual flavor and identity.
예: America is often described as a salad bowl, where different cultures maintain their distinct identities while coexisting.
메모: Contrasts with the melting pot concept by emphasizing maintaining distinct identities alongside unity.

Mosaic Society

Refers to a society composed of diverse elements that come together to create a harmonious whole.
예: Our country is evolving into a mosaic society, with different ethnicities and traditions blending harmoniously.
메모: Suggests that each individual element, like a piece in a mosaic, contributes to the overall beauty and diversity.
